Default Volume envelope won't make a straight line

I just upgraded from Reaper v3, and I'm having issues with volume envelopes. When I try to create a straight line from unity to -30 or so, it won't make a straight line, it adds in a corner partway down, so that the volume goes down more slowly for the first half, and then speeds up for the second half. I don't understand what it's doing, and how to turn it off so that the line just goes straight between the 2 points.

One of the numerous things where Reaper does something helpful but doesn't make it clear, so it looks wrong.

It *is* a straight line, under the hood. The envelope is drawn with a different scale below 0db than above 0db - I think the idea is that automation is typically finely-detailed volume cuts, where you want more specific control, and automated boosts don't.

There might be a setting somewhere related to it; not sure.

a corner?

check what the point shape is you are using for your points... it sounds like the one want is 'linear'... but it also sounds like you are currently using some other shape

there are actions to change the shape and the selections for point shape is also in menu... and do know that you can have point of diff shapes on the same envelope... so you gotta pay attention

EDIT: actually just tested what you have said... with the linear shape and I see what you are talking about
it's good to set the env. to read mode to watch the sliders respond...

I'm not totally sure but I think we are seeing something that has to do with how meter scale is visually shown... in that the distance between the higher and lower values is not equal for the whole scale... the actual vol. change likely is OK but how it looks is as you describe

Also... you might actually try other shapes like the bezier where you can hold the alt key and tweak the shape quite radically... which may give you more what you are after... just a thought
